Hot-dipped galvanized coatings are a type of corrosion protection coating applied to steel products. The coating is created by immersing the steel product in a bath of molten zinc, which reacts with the steel to form a series of zinc-iron alloy layers. The resulting coating is a durable, corrosion-resistant barrier that protects the steel from environmental degradation.
